Storing a Flat or Spare Tire and
Tools With a Screw in Fastener

1. Turn the wrench

counterclockwise to remove the
fastener.

2. Replace the fastener with the

one provided in the foam.

3. Turn the wrench clockwise to

tighten the fastener.

4. Replace the foam, jack and

tools, and the tire.

5. Turn the retainer nut clockwise

to secure the tire.

6. Place the floor cover on the

wheel.

Storing a Flat or Spare Tire and
Tools With a Slide In Fastener

1. If the flat tire is larger than the

spare tire, use the longer
mounting bolt from the tool bag.

2. Slide the shorter bolt to remove

it from the floor and insert the
longer one.

3. Replace the jack and tools in

their original storage location.

4. Place the tire, lying flat, facing

up in the spare tire well.

5. Turn the retainer nut clockwise

to secure the tire.

6. Place the floor cover on the

wheel.

To store the compact spare tire, use
the shorter mounting bolt.

The compact spare is for temporary
use only. Replace the compact
spare tire with a full-size tire as
soon as you can.

Compact Spare Tire

{

WARNING

Driving with more than one
compact spare tire at a time could
result in loss of braking and
handling. This could lead to a
crash and you or others could be
injured. Use only one compact
spare tire at a time.
